Every council or building authority in Australia has its own rules and regulations when it comes to SHEDS whether it is Garden Sheds, Storage Sheds, Garages or Barns so it is always wise to check before you make a purchase.

 

Most council’s allow a garden shed up to 10 sq metres to be erected without a permit.

The most common shed size to fit this requirement is a 3m x 3m shed (9 square metres), but you can go bigger thanks to some clever thinking by the people at Durabuilt who make the EasySHED range.

Imagine having a bigger shed say 4.3m x 2.25m (9.6 square metres), this is possible using the EasySHED Truss Shed model 0404E 4.5m x 2.25m and making some simple adjustments.

 

All you need to do is cut (using a hacksaw or angle grinder), 235mm from the channels on the 4.5m side (4 wall channels and 4 roof channels and 235mm from the roof ridge beam), then overlap 1 rib in the front and back walls and the 2 roof panels and there you have it. A much bigger shed without the need for permit fees

This shed has the added strength of a truss frame and overlapping these wall panels will also add strength. Even better for the taller person you can chose to increase the wall height of this shed from 1.8m to 1.98m or even 2.10m for just a little extra!

Storm Shed

 

For several years now, customers have been asking us for a garden shed that would comply with the building regulations imposed in high wind areas of Australia, as up until now, there has been no garden shed on the Australian market that has been able to successfully meet these high standards.
Therefore, we are very pleased to announce the arrival of the revolutionary storm shed.

 

As the name suggests, StormSHED® has been designed to handle severe storm conditions and is engineered to Region D Category 2 Cyclonic wind conditions of 88m/sec (316kms per hour), when erected and anchored according to the instructions.

The Durabuilt StormSHED® is the FIRST GARDEN SHED IN AUSTRALIA to be rated to Region D Category 2 Cyclonic wind conditions!

StormSHED® comes in 3 sizes with 625 colour options (25 roof colours and 25 wall colours), giving your customer the widest range of colours available in the Australian shed market. Each shed comes complete with all parts and ground anchors.

The StormSHED® is suitable not just for the tropical north of Australia but in any location, particularly coastal locations, where stronger than normal wind speeds occur.
